Files
collective-memory-repo/daily/2026-03-19.md

2.8 KiB
Raw Blame History

2026-03-19

自建 Gitea / CLI-Anything / tea 约定

  • hotwa 说明:/cli-anything 对应可用二进制路径为 /opt/homebrew/bin/tea
  • 可使用以下方式为 tea 添加登录并做后续测试:
    • tea login add --name "$GITEA_LOGIN_NAME" --url "$GITEA_URL" --token "$GITEA_TOKEN"
  • hotwa 在自建 Gitea https://gitea.jmsu.top 上为 Claw 创建了专属账号:work2ai
  • 该 Gitea 中的 lingyuzeng 账号即 hotwa 本人的代码仓库账号
  • 后续应记住:gitea.jmsu.top 是 hotwalingyuzeng)的自建 Giteawork2ai 是提供给 Claw 使用的专属账号
  • hotwa 后续计划再为 Claw 创建可用于访问该 Gitea 仓库的 GPG 密钥
  • hotwa 补充:自建 Gitea 首选访问地址为 https://gitea.jmsu.top;若 HTTPS 外网访问失败,可回退使用 http://100.64.0.27:8418 访问 Gitea 服务
  • hotwa 确认新的仓库目录规范:今后 Gitea / GitHub 账号克隆下来的代码仓库统一放到 ~/project/workspace/...(如 ~/project/workspace/gitea/...~/project/workspace/github/...),不要放在 ~/openclawd/vaults,以避免污染 OpenClaw 的记忆/运行区
  • 已完成 work2ai 的 Gitea SSH/tea 接入扩展到 mac-6mac-7
    • mac-6 生成 key ~/.ssh/work2ai_gitea_mac6_ed25519,注册到 Gitea user key id 19title work2ai-mac6-giteafingerprint SHA256:VSBwTJ7OA7hOMGnlbqM1undwzszrCGHR45p3KT8K3CE
    • mac-7 生成 key ~/.ssh/work2ai_gitea_mac7_ed25519,注册到 Gitea user key id 20title work2ai-mac7-giteafingerprint SHA256:bzlSYi6JR+T5o+0ka/M4ihSPZj8pTw83Y1Z+6wYqous
    • 两台机器都写入了 ~/.ssh/configgitea-work2ai host 别名(HostName gitea.jmsu.top, Port 2222, User git, IdentitiesOnly yes
    • 两台机器都完成验证:ssh -T gitea-work2ai 认证成功、git ls-remote gitea-work2ai:work2ai/agent.git 成功、tea login add 成功、tea api user 返回 work2ai
  • 已按方案 B 清理三台机器的 Homebrew opencode formula只保留 opencode-desktop cask
    • mac-5 / mac-6 / mac-7 均已执行 brew uninstall opencode
    • 三台机器的 opencode --version 保持为 1.2.27
    • /opt/homebrew/bin/opencode 继续指向 ../lib/node_modules/opencode-ai/bin/opencode
  • hotwa 新偏好:后续调用 opencode / ACP 时,优先使用 opencode zen 提供的免费模型;当前 mac-6、mac-7 默认工作模型应使用 MiMo V2 Pro Free
  • 集群新增已配对并连通节点:mac-mini-m4-16ghotwa 后续要求默认简称其为 mac-mini
  • 当前 mac-mini 虽已作为 node 接入 gatewaysystem.run 仍受本机 ~/.openclaw/exec-approvals.json 约束;若要像 mac-6 一样免批准执行,需要在 mac-mini 上同步等效的 exec approvals 策略(不建议直接盲拷整个文件中的 socket 字段)。